Secretary Of State Hillary Clinton And Haiti President Elect Michel Martelly
Here is a photo, Secretary Of State Hillary Clinton And Haiti President Elect Michel Martelly, from a briefing at the US State Department.
US Secretary of State Hillary Rodham Clinton met with Haitian President-Elect Michel Martelly at the State Department on April 20, 2011.
This was Michel Martelly's first visit to Washington as President-elect of Haiti
Bassin Zim Water Fall
Not far from the town of Hinche Haiti is an amazing water fall called Bassin Zim.
Bassin Zim is one of the hidden treasures of Haiti that has never been explored. Bassin Zim is not just a water fall. The river that becomes this beautiful water called Bassin Zim comes shooting out of a whole in the mountain top, behind a cave.
The water then goes through three natural pools before finally creating the water fall.
I've been told that behind the water fall is another cave and visitors has swam through the water fall into the cave.
